Responsibilities
- Provides technical and programmatic information assurance services to internal and external customers in support of network and information security systems.
- Designs, develops, and implements security requirements within an organization's business processes. Prepares documentation from information obtained from customer using accepted guidelines.
Prepares security test and evaluation plans.
- Provides certification and accreditation support in the development of security and contingency plans and conducts complex risk and vulnerability assessments.
- Analyzes policies and procedures against Federal laws and regulations and provides recommendations for closing gaps.
- Recommends system enhancements to improve security deficiencies.
- Develops, tests, and integrates computer and network security tools.
- Secures system configurations and installs security tools, scans systems to determine compliancy and report results and evaluates products and various aspects of system administration.
- Conducts security program audits and develops solutions to lessen identified risks.
- Provides information assurance support for the development and implementation of security architectures to meet new and evolving security requirements.
- Provides assistance in computer incident investigations.
- Performs vulnerability assessments including development of risk mitigation strategies.
